PINEAPPLE-COCONUT SAUCE



Pineapple-Coconut Sauce image

Crushed pineapple in its own juice forms the base of a luxurious tropical sauce flavored with coconut. Make it in minutes and serve it with coconut shrimp with rice or egg noodles. Make ahead of time and refrigerate so flavors meld together.

Number Of Ingredients 3

¾ cup crushed pineapple in juice, divided
½ cup cream of coconut, divided
¼ cup heavy whipping cream

Steps:

  • Blend 1/2 cup crushed pineapple and cream of coconut in a blender until smooth. Add heavy cream and pulse to blend; pour into a bowl.
  • Fold remaining crushed pineapple into the blended mixture. Cover b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ate at least 30 minutes.

EASY COCONUT SHRIMP (RED LOBSTER RECIPE)



Easy Coconut Shrimp (Red Lobster Recipe) image

A healthier version of Red Lobster's Coconut Shrimp Recipe that is made with unsweetened shredded coconut, Panko bread crumbs, and then lightly pan-fried in coconut oil. Serve them with an easy pineapple and yogurt dipping sauce for dinner or in tacos for a quick lunch!

Number Of Ingredients 16

1 lb. shrimp (peeled and deveined, tails on or off)
⅓ cup flour (gluten free 1-to-1 blend)
½ tsp. paprika
¾ tsp. salt (divided)
¼ tsp. black pepper
1 large egg
1 Tbsp. milk (almond or cashew)
¾ cup unsweetened coconut (finely shredded)
½ cup Panko bread crumbs (gluten-free)
¼ - ½ cup coconut oil
⅓ cup yogurt (plain, Greek, or dairy-free)
¼ cup crushed pineapple (canned, drained)
2 Tbsp. unsweetened coconut (finely shredded)
2 tsp. sugar (or coconut sugar)
⅛ - ¼ salt (to taste)
See this recipe in Healthy Meal Plan #2

Steps:

  • Place shrimp into a large bowl and add flour, paprika, ½ tsp. salt, and pepper. Toss until coated.
  • Whisk together egg and milk in a medium-sized shallow bowl.
  • Place shredded coconut, Panko breadcrumbs, and ¼ teaspoon of salt in a second, medium-sized, shallow bowl. Toss to combine.
  • Remove flour-coated shrimp from the bowl and dip in egg bowl. Let excess egg run off and then coat completely in shredded coconut/panko breadcrumbs. Place on a baking sheet or plate and repeat with remaining shrimp.
  • Add 1-2 tablespoons of coconut oil to a large non-stick or stainless steel skillet over medium heat.
  • Cook 5-6 shrimp for two minutes on each side, or until shrimp are done cooking. (You'll know this when they start to curl up!) Remove cooked shrimp and place on a paper towel to drain excess oil. Repeat this step with remaining shrimp.

BAKED COCONUT SHRIMP WITH PINEAPPLE SAUCE



Baked Coconut Shrimp with Pineapple Sauce image

I love the big succulent coconut shrimp found at a popular restaurant. Unfortunately, due to health reasons I can't indulge in that shrimp anymore. I created a recipe that satisfies my craving and tastes just as indulgent, but without the guilt! Can be served as an entree or as an appetizer.

Number Of Ingredients 13

½ cup cornstarch
3 egg whites
1 teaspoon coconut extract
1 cup panko bread crumbs
1 cup flaked unsweetened coconut
2 (1 gram) packets sucralose sweetener
16 large shrimp - peeled, deveined, and butterflied with tails on
salt and ground black pepper to taste
cooking spray
1 (8 ounce) can crushed pineapple with juice
½ teaspoon chili garlic sauce
1 (1 gram) packet sucralose sweetener
salt and ground black p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• Place cornstarch in a small bowl. Beat egg whites and coconut extract in a second bowl with a fork until almost forming peaks. Mix bread crumbs, coconut, and sucralose in a third bowl.
  • Dredge shrimp, one at a time, in cornstarch, then in the egg mixture, and finally in the bread crumb mixture. Place the breaded shrimp on a plate; season with salt and pepper. Spray both sides of shrimp with cooking spray and place on a nonstick baking sheet.
  • Bake in the preheated oven, about 10 minutes, flipping halfway through the cooking time.
  • Meanwhile, combine canned pineapple, chili garlic sauce, and sucralose in a food processor or blender. Blend until completely smooth; season with salt and pepper. Serve shrimp with dipping sauce immediately after baking.

COCONUT SHRIMP WITH PINEAPPLE HERB DIPPING SAUCE



Coconut Shrimp with Pineapple Herb Dipping Sauce image

Serve baked, coconut-crusted shrimp with a bright dipping sauce for an appetizer that'll please a whole host of palates.

Number Of Ingredients 13

Coconut Shrimp:
1/2 cup unsweetened shredded coconut
1/4 cup whole wheat flour
2 large egg whites
1 tablespoon water
1/2 cup panko bread crumbs
18 large shrimp, shelled and deveined with tail part of shell left on
1 tablespoon low-sodium soy sauce
1/8 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
Pineapple Herb Dipping Sauce:
1/2 (8-ounce) can pineapple chunks in juice
1/2 cup loosely packed fresh herbs (basil, rosemary, parsley)
Juice of 1/2 lime

Steps:

  • Prepare the Coconut Shrimp: Preheat oven to 350°F. Spread coconut on an ungreased baking sheet. Toast in the oven for 3-5 minutes or until golden brown, stirring frequently to ensure even cooking. Transfer coconut to a pie plate; cool.
  • Turn oven temperature up to 425°F. Grease the same baking sheet. Place flour in a small bowl. In another small bowl, whisk egg whites with water until foamy. Stir panko into the coconut in the pie plate. In a large bowl, toss shrimp with soy sauce and pepper.
  • One at a time, hold shrimp by tail and coat with flour, shaking off excess; then dip in egg white mixture. Finally, roll in coconut mixture to coat well.
  • Place shrimp on the prepared baking sheet. Bake for 10-12 minutes or until shrimp are opaque throughout and coating is crisp.
  • Meanwhile, prepare the Pineapple Herb Dipping Sauce: Drain pineapple, reserving 1/4 cup juice. In a food processor, pulse pineapple, reserved pineapple juice, herbs, and lime juice until blended.
  • Serve coconut shrimp with dipping sauce.

WHOLE30 COCONUT-CRUSTED SHRIMP WITH PINEAPPLE-CHILI SAUCE



Whole30 Coconut-Crusted Shrimp with Pineapple-Chili Sauce image

Think just because you're in Whole30 mode, indulgent dishes like coconut-crusted shrimp are off limits? In this ingenious rendition, you can dig right in, all the way down to the delectable sweet-and-sour dipping sauce.

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 pound peeled and deveined large shrimp, tails removed
1 cup unsweetened shredded coconut
Zest and juice of 1 lime
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
2 large egg whites
1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ro
1/4 teaspoon red pepper flakes
1 small clove garlic
1/2 small fresh pineapple, peeled, cored and roughly chopped

Steps:

  • Preheat the broiler and line a baking sheet with a wire rack. Thread 3 shrimp onto each of seven 6-inch skewers and set aside.
  • Combine the coconut, lime zest, 1 teaspoon salt and a few grinds of black pepper in a shallow bowl. Brush the shrimp with the egg whites, then press into the coconut mixture until completely coated. Transfer to the prepared baking sheet and broil, flipping halfway through, until the coconut is crispy and golden brown and the shrimp are pink and no longer opaque in the middle, 3 to 4 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, blend the cilantro, red pepper flakes, garlic, pineapple and lime juice in a blender until smooth and vibrant green. Serve alongside the shrimp.

BAKED COCONUT SHRIMP WITH PINEAPPLE DIPPING SAUCE RECIPE - (4.5/5)

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 Tablespoon lime juice
2 teaspoons finely chopped fresh jalapeno pepper
1/2 cup pineapple preserves
1 pound uncooked large shrimp peeled and deveined
2 egg whites
2 Tablespoons cornstarch
2 cups sweetened flaked coconut

Steps:

  • Combine lime juice, jalapeno pepper, and pineapple preserves in a small bowl and mix well. Cover and refrigerate until ready to serve. Preheat oven to 400 degrees and line a cookie sheet with parchment paper. In a small bowl beat egg whites with a hand mixer until soft peaks form. Place cornstarch and coconut on two separate plates. Hold shrimp by the tail and dip and coat the shrimp with cornstarch. Next, dip the shrimp in the egg whites and finally in the coconut coating well. Place shrimp on the cookie sheet and bake for 15-17 minutes or until coconut is a golden brown. Make sure to turn it once halfway through (around 8 minutes into cooking time) to make sure both sides brown. Serve with pineapple dipping sauce.

SLAM DUNK COCONUT SHRIMP DIPPING SAUCE



Slam Dunk Coconut Shrimp Dipping Sauce image

This is our favorite dipping sauce for coconut shrimp. The heat from the horseradish combined with the sweet apricot and citrus pineapple flavors makes this a real slam dunk! This freezes well.

Number Of Ingredients 3

1 (18 ounce) jar apricot preserves (such as SMUCKER'S® Apricot Preserves)
4 teaspoons prepared horseradish
1 cup crushed pineapple

Steps:

  • Mix apricot preserves and horseradish in a bowl; stir in pineapple. Cover and refrigerate until ready to serve.
